


3-Card Combination
Embracing Change and Rest
This combination of cards speaks to the cyclical nature of life and the importance of rest during transitions. The blend of fortune, contemplation, and generosity invites you to reflect on how to balance personal needs with the needs of others.
Wheel of Fortune
Upright: good luck, karma, life cycles, destiny
Reversed: bad luck, lack of control, clinging to control
Four of Swords
Upright: rest, restoration, contemplation, recuperation
Reversed: restlessness, burnout, lack of progress
Six of Pentacles
Upright: giving, receiving, sharing wealth, generosity
Reversed: strings attached, stinginess, power dynamics
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, you're in a period of positive change and growth. The Wheel of Fortune suggests that good luck is on your side, while the Four of Swords encourages you to take time for rest and reflection. The Six of Pentacles highlights the importance of giving and receiving support, reminding you that generosity enriches your journey.
Wheel of Fortune Reversed
When the Wheel of Fortune is reversed, it indicates a feeling of being stuck or experiencing bad luck. You may feel as though circumstances are beyond your control, leading to frustration. This card encourages you to recognize that change is still possible, but it may require a shift in perspective.
Four of Swords Reversed
The reversed Four of Swords suggests restlessness or an inability to take a break, which can lead to burnout. You might be avoiding necessary reflection or self-care, pushing through without addressing your mental or emotional needs. It’s crucial to allow yourself the time to recharge.
Six of Pentacles Reversed
With the Six of Pentacles reversed, there may be imbalances in giving and receiving. You might feel taken advantage of, or you could be withholding support from others. This card urges you to reassess your boundaries and ensure that generosity flows both ways.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, it signifies a challenging period marked by stagnation, restlessness, and imbalance. You may feel overwhelmed by circumstances, struggling to find the balance between self-care and your obligations to others. This combination calls for deep reflection and a reevaluation of your priorities.
Love & Relationships
In love and relationships, this combination reversed suggests miscommunication and imbalance. You may be giving too much without receiving the same level of commitment, or you could be avoiding deeper emotional connections. Take time to reassess what you truly want and need from your partner.
Career & Finances
In terms of career and finances, this combination indicates potential setbacks or feelings of being unfulfilled. You may feel overworked without adequate recognition or support, leading to dissatisfaction. It's a time to reflect on your career path and consider whether you are in the right place.
Advice
Take the time to rest and recharge, especially when faced with uncertainty. Reflect on what changes you desire and how you can create balance in your life. Practice generosity but ensure that it is mutual, allowing for a healthier flow of energy in your relationships.
